Razvojno okruženje za procesor za digitalnu obradu kompleksnih signala (CROSBI ID 385460)
Ocjenski rad | diplomski rad
Podaci o odgovornosti
Macut, Goran
Vučić, Mladen
hrvatski
Razvojno okruženje za procesor za digitalnu obradu kompleksnih signala
Algoritmi koji se izvode na procesorima za digitalnu obradu signala vrlo su specifični. Iz tog je razloga izvedba procesora za digitalnu obradu signala najčešće optimirana za izvođenje upravo takvih algoritama. Tipični viši programski jezici uglavnom ne nude jednostavan način opisa funkcionalnosti koje podržavaju takve arhitekture. Kako bi se omogućio lakši i brži razvoj programske podrške za te platforme, potrebno je razviti posebne prilagođene više programske jezike. U diplomskom radu predstavljeni su jezici CDSP asm i CDSP C, temeljeni na programskom jeziku C, te odgovarajući prevodioci koji omogućavaju prevođenje i pripremu programa za procesor za digitalnu obradu kompleksnih podataka (engl. Complex Digital Signal Processor – CDSP). Ti jezici imaju neke posebne mogućnosti poput rada s kompleksnim tipovima podataka i rada s više podatkovnih memorija, a podržavaju i frakcionalnu aritmetiku.
obrada kompleksnih signala; procesor za digitalnu obradu signala; asembler; povezivač; C prevodilac
nije evidentirano
engleski
Design environment for complex digital signal processor
nije evidentirano
processing of complex signals; digital signal processor; assembler; linker; C compiler
nije evidentirano
Podaci o izdanju
104
27.02.2014.
obranjeno
Podaci o ustanovi koja je dodijelila akademski stupanj
Fakultet elektrotehnike i računarstva
Zagreb